The barriers between Bollywood & Hollywood have been broken multiple times, with legitimate actors from Bollywood crossing over for movies in Hollywood, like Bollywood actor Irfan Khan in ‘The Amazing Spiderman’ (my Review here) and upcoming ‘Jurassic World’. While ethnicity doesn’t always play a factor, majority of these crossovers happen due to fulfilling a minority role, or in a story that is set in India (‘Slumdog Millionaire’) or with Indian character (‘Life Of Pi’) That is however, until now.

Broken Horses, written, produced and directed by Vidhu Vinod Chopra starring Vincent D'Onofrio, Anton Yelchin, Thomas Jane & Sean Patrick Flannery releasing April 10th, 2015

Director of back in the day Bollywood classics like ‘1942: A Love Story’ and producer of the massive commercial hits like ‘Munnabhai M.B.B.S.’, Vidhu Vinod Chopra is directing his first Hollywood movie with an all star (kind of) Hollywood cast.

Broken Horses starring Vincent D'Onofrio, Anton Yelchin, Thomas Jane & Sean Patrick Flannery

A story about two brothers set against a US-Mexico border gang war, ‘Broken Horses’ features very known Hollywood faces and some with major cult following like Anton Yelchin (‘Star Trek Into Darkness’), Vincent D’Onofrio, (‘Men In Black’) Thomas Jane, (‘The Punisher’) & Sean Patrick Flannery (‘The Boondock Saints’). A quick look at the movie’s IMDB page shows Jane & Yelchin’s character having the same last name, meaning they could be the brothers mentioned in the synopsis.

Despite being a Hollywood movie written, produced and directed by a Bollywood Director, Chopra insists that there is nothing Indian about the movie itself, which would be unprecedented and make ‘Broken Horses’ the first ever Hollywood film to be made by a Bollywood director.
